interface
Configure a physical or virtual interface on the switch.
Syntax
interface interface 
Parameters
interface
Enter one of the following keywords and the interface information:
• For a null interface, enter the keyword null then the slot/port information. The Null 
interface number is 0.
• For the Management interface on the stack-unit, enter the keyword 
ManagementEthernet then the slot/port information.
• For a Loopback interface, enter the keyword loopback then a number from 0 to 
16383.
• For a 10-Gigabit Ethernet interface, enter the keyword TenGigabitEthernet then 
the 
stack/slot/port/subport information.
• For a 25-Gigabit Ethernet interface, enter the keyword twentyFiveGigE then the 
stack/slot/port/subport information.
• For a 40-Gigabit Ethernet interface, enter the keyword fortyGigE then the stack/
slot/port[/subport] information.
• For a 50-Gigabit Ethernet interface, enter the keyword fiftyGigE then the stack/
slot/port/subport information.
• For a 100-Gigabit Ethernet interface, enter the keyword hundredGigE then the 
stack/slot/port information.
• For a Tunnel interface, enter the keyword tunnel then the tunnel ID. The range is 
from 1 to 16383.
• For a VLAN interface, enter the keyword vlan then a number from 1 to 4094.
• For a port channel interface, enter the keywords port-channel then a number.
Defaults Not configured.
Command Modes CONFIGURATION
